McDougall John

    An American-Irish physician and author, his philosophy posits that degenerative diseases can be prevented and treated through a low-fat, whole foods, plant-based diet. This approach notably centers on starches like potatoes, rice, and corn, while excluding all animal foods and added vegetable oils. His work highlights the transformative power of diet in combating chronic illness.

      The bestselling author and renowned physician presents an appealing health solution: enjoy the foods you love to lose weight and improve your health. Traditionally, we’ve been advised to focus on meat, poultry, and fish while avoiding carbohydrates, especially starchy foods. However, this perspective may be misguided. High-calorie animal fats and proteins often lead to hunger and overeating, contributing to various health issues such as indigestion, obesity, diabetes, heart disease, and cancer. In contrast, complex carbohydrates like whole grains, legumes, and tubers provide essential nutrients that satisfy hunger and combat illness. Dr. John McDougall, a leading nutrition expert featured in the documentary Forks Over Knives, notes that Americans consume only about forty percent of their calories from carbohydrates. This guide encourages us to reclaim our health by embracing nutritious starches, vegetables, and fruits. McDougall challenges the misleading narratives of high-fat fad diets and offers a straightforward approach to eating that promotes disease prevention, enhances physical fitness, and supports environmental sustainability. With easy-to-follow recipes for dishes like buckwheat pancakes, baked potato skins, and dairy-free lasagna, this resource aims to transform your understanding of health and nutrition, helping you look and feel your best.
